What Is Vehicle Transportation?


Vehicle transportation, also referred to as car shipping or auto transport, is a service offered by vehicle shipping companies that involves collecting your automobile from one location and transporting it to another. This service is beneficial in various circumstances where you are unable to drive the vehicle yourself, such as when purchasing or selling a used car online and need to transport it to another state, or when you've relocated and require long-distance vehicle shipping. Auto transport services are also useful when you need to move your car overseas, and unless ferry services are available, you'll have to rely on a vehicle shipping company to manage the job. Luckily, there are numerous car transport services available to cater to your specific requirements, which we'll explore below.


Types Of Vehicle Shipping Services


When it comes to vehicle shipping services, there are several options to consider. The first choice you'll need to make is where you want your automobile collected from and delivered to, whether it's a long-distance vehicle transport or shipping a car to another state. Terminal-to-terminal auto delivery is one possibility, where designated collection and drop-off points, often the vehicle transport company's stores or operating bases, are used. While terminal-to-terminal auto delivery is typically more affordable, it requires more effort on your part to get the vehicle home.


Most individuals, however, opt for a door-to-door auto transport delivery service, where their vehicles are collected and dropped off at their doorstep, regardless of whether it's a long-distance vehicle transport or just shipping a car to another state. This option is more convenient as you don't need to go anywhere to collect your automobile, which can be challenging without your car in the first place!


Vehicle transport services generally fall into two categories: having someone drive your car to its destination or putting it on a trailer and transporting it.


Have Someone Drive Your Vehicle


Hiring someone to drive your automobile to its destination is a straightforward solution for vehicle shipping, whether you need to ship a car across the country or to another state. The advantages of this auto transport method include lower costs, as trailers and an extra vehicle are not required, and faster delivery due to the simplicity of the transport process. However, there are some drawbacks to this method offered by vehicle shipping companies that lead some people to choose other types of car transport.


Firstly, mileage is added to your automobile during the journey, which can be significant when shipping a car across the country, although less so when shipping a car to a nearby state. Secondly, there is a slight risk of damage to your vehicle while it's being driven from point A to point B. These concerns are particularly relevant for people buying or selling cars online who want to ensure the automobile arrives in the same condition as advertised.


Put Your Vehicle On A Trailer


Putting your automobile on a trailer is a safer way to ensure a higher level of protection than having someone drive your car to its destination. When it comes to vehicle shipping trailers, there are several options available depending on the value and size of your automobile.


First, you'll need to decide whether you want a single trailer for your vehicle. Single trailers are often more expensive as they only transport one car at a time, but they're an excellent choice if you're moving an expensive or classic automobile that you don't want to risk damaging. The safest way to transport a car is to put it in a shipping container, but this is by far the most expensive option.


The other option is a multi-car transporter, which can transport several vehicles at once. There are a few variants of multi-car transporters:


Open vehicle shipping is the cheapest and most common option offered by car shipping companies. Your automobile is placed on an open carrier and driven to its destination. While all cars are securely fastened, they are exposed to the elements during the drive, so this may not be recommended by vehicle shipping companies for highly valuable automobiles. Additionally, long journeys in open trailers pose a higher risk of damage and expose your car to the elements for extended periods, even though it may be the cheapest way to ship a vehicle cross-country.


Enclosed auto transport involves securing multiple cars on a carrier, but they are enclosed, protecting them from dust, weather, and debris during transit. This option is often preferable for more expensive or newer vehicles where the owner wants to minimize the risk of damage during auto transport.


If you need to move your automobile overseas through an auto transport company, try to find a specialist service on our platform or one with experience in overseas vehicle shipping, as they can provide tailored advice based on your requirements.


How Much Does It Cost To Ship A Vehicle?


The cost of shipping a vehicle varies based on several factors, but on average, auto transport companies in the US charge around $2.92 per mile for journeys less than 200 miles, $0.93 for journeys between 200 and 500 miles, and $0.78 for journeys over 1,000 miles. However, these are just averages for vehicle moving companies, and your car transport may cost more or less depending on your specific circumstances. The best way to determine the cost of auto transport is to obtain vehicle shipping quotes from car transport companies, which is easy to do on Shiply.


To get an idea of what to expect in terms of vehicle delivery costs, let's examine the factors that can affect the price of car transport services.


Factors That Can Affect The Cost Of Auto Transport


While we all want affordable vehicle transport, several factors and variables can impact the cost of your car shipping. Below, we'll outline the main ones to help you understand whether your auto transport requirements will be expensive or affordable.


As mentioned earlier, distance plays a significant role in determining the cost of your vehicle transport. Cross-state and cross-country journeys are more expensive than interstate car delivery, which is often the most affordable vehicle shipping option. Although longer distances cost more, the average price per mile decreases as the journey length increases, ensuring you're not paying excessively.


International shipping always results in expensive vehicle shipping quotes due to the logistics of transferring a car overseas and the distance it must travel. It may also require special enclosed trailers or even a shipping container for your automobile.


The route required to take your vehicle from its pick-up spot to its delivery location can also affect the pricing of your car carrier service. Routes with known higher traffic, such as in LA, may cost more than quieter roads due to the additional time added to the journey. Similarly, unforeseen circumstances like major roadworks could incur extra costs from vehicle moving companies or necessitate a different, longer route.


The speed at which you need your vehicle transportation service to operate can also impact the price. If you're able to be flexible with timings, you may find that your car shipping service charges less, as they can fit your automobile delivery into their schedule and reduce overheads, passing the savings on to you. However, if you require auto transport within a strict timeframe (often known as expedited shipping), it will typically cost more, as the vehicle transport company may need to dedicate a trailer and driver solely for your delivery.


The height, length, and width of the automobile will all affect the cost of transport. Car shippers will require larger trailers for bigger vehicles, with SUVs typically costing more on average to transport than sedans. Always inform the auto transport company about any bike racks, roof racks, or other accessories on the car, as these can change the size of the trailer required for delivery.


If your vehicle is not in drivable condition, it may make your auto transport more expensive. This is because it may require extra equipment, such as a winch or forklift, to load and unload your car from the trailer. For example, if your automobile has a locked wheel, it will be impossible to simply roll it onto a trailer and off again, taking more time, effort, and machinery to complete the delivery than a standard vehicle transport service. Most car carriers consider a vehicle that can brake, roll, and steer to be in good enough condition to ship easily.


The type of auto transport service you select will also affect the cost of your vehicle shipping. Having someone drive your car to its destination will always be the most affordable option, as you're essentially just paying for a driver's time and fuel. Single car trailers and enclosed transport are likely to be more expensive, as they require extra equipment. Enclosed vehicle shipping is always the most expensive method of shipping a car, as it means your automobile travels alone and still needs specialist equipment to load, unload, and protect it during transport.


The locations of pickup and delivery can also increase the price of shipping a vehicle. Urban areas usually have car shipping services in close proximity, and if it's a common destination route, you'll tend to get affordable vehicle shipping. Rural deliveries can cost more, as they require deviations from normal routes and extra mileage for the company. If a pick-up or drop-off point is in an unusual or hard-to-access space, extra steps may be needed to load your automobile, which can also increase the vehicle shipping cost.


While all auto transport companies are required to carry liability insurance, many do not offer additional insurance, as it's not required by law. If a vehicle transport company does not offer cargo insurance, it's highly recommended that you seek out and acquire some for your automobile during transit. As with all insurance policies, make sure you understand what type of damage is covered, whether there is a deductible, which parts of the vehicle are covered by the insurance, and any other questions you may have.


Seasonality can also affect the price of vehicle shipping, with many services costing more to ship a car in the winter due to ice and snow slowing the routes. Here's a quick breakdown of how each season can affect auto transport costs:


Winter is often the most expensive season to ship your automobile. Ice, snow, and blizzard conditions can all cause delays on the roads and reduce the maximum speed at which the vehicle delivery service can transport cars. December is typically a difficult time to have a vehicle shipped, as drivers are on holiday, while many travel to warmer states in January, leading to increased automobile shipping costs. However, February is usually quiet, so great rates are often available from vehicle shipping services during this month.


Spring is a great time to ship your automobile with a vehicle transportation service. With improved weather conditions, longer days, and more drivers ready to work, Spring can often mean affordable rates and high availability when it comes to moving your car. March is often a better time to ship than April or May, as there is often a rush to move vehicles from colder to warmer states.


Summer is the prime season for shipping cars - the days are the longest in the year, students are traveling home from universities, employees take vacations, and it's also a very popular time to move house. This means that June, July, and August are all busy months for the auto transport industry, and you should not expect affordable vehicle shipping during the summer.


Fall is a good time to ship a car if you're looking for a slightly more affordable price. Vehicle shipping companies are less busy, and there is typically more driver availability after the summer rush. However, you're better off looking to move your automobile in October or November rather than September, as this is peak time for students shipping their cars to university.

Once you select a company, there are a few things you gotta do to get your car ready for shipping. First, ensure you have any crucial documents ready, like if you're selling the vehicle. Clean out all your personal belongings too, & give it a good wash so you can spot any damages that happen during shipping. If your car needs to be driven at all, check that it's running right with enough fluids, battery charge, & tire pressure.


The most critical thing is to take tons of pics of your car from every angle before it gets picked up. That way, you got proof of what condition it was in if anything goes wrong. When it gets delivered, check that everything is working right away - lights, brakes, engine, etc. Compare the outside to your pics & make sure the mileage matches up too. Does Someone Have To Be Present For Pickup And Delivery?

In most cases, the car shipping company will require you to be in attendance for the pickup and delivery of the vehicle. This is because there are likely to be release forms that you need to sign, as well as handing over the car keys.

Can I Keep Items In My Vehicle?

Most car transport companies will be fine with you keeping some personal items in the vehicle when it is transported. However, there are two important things to remember: 1. The weight of the items may affect the price of the vehicle shipment, and 2. Any items in the vehicle will not be covered by insurance for the transport of the car itself.

Can I Transport My Vehicle If It Isn't Running?

You can ship your vehicle if it isn’t in running condition, however, this will be more expensive as specialist equipment is required to load and unload the vehicle.
